Vespasian. AD 69-79. Æ sestertius (25,46 g). Rome mint, struck AD 71. IMP CAES VESPASIAN AVG P M TR P P P COS III, Laureate head right / IVDAEA CAPTA, Palm tree; to left of tree, Vespasian standing right, foot on helmet, holding spear and parazonium; to right of tree, mourning Jewess seated right on cuirass. Some roughess. Small area of fill and smoothing of red encrustations. Green patina with areas of darker and lighter tones. An attractive specimen of great historic importance. RIC II.1 167, Hendin 1504, Ex Classical Numismatic Group, auction 97, 17.10.2014, lot 633 Grade: 1+/01
